What is the difference between a dental assistant and a dental hygienist?

0

Both the dental hygienist and dental assistant are integral members of the dental team. The dental assistant works directly with the dentist in what is generally referred to as chairside, or four handed dentistry in a variety of procedures, as well as exposes radiographs if licensed to do so. The dental assistant can also perform other expanded duties if credentialed as a Certified Dental Assistant (CDA), or and Expanded Functions Dental Assistant (EFDA).
